NI Bluetooth Analysis Toolkit

Packet Settings:LE Access Address Property

  • Updated2023-02-21
  • 1 minute(s) read

Short Name: LE Access Address

Property of niBTAnalysis

Specifies the 32-bit LE access address.

The Bluetooth core specification recommends to use 0x71764129 as the LE access address for all test packets. This value will be used for burst synchronization if the Burst synchronization Type property is set to Access Code and the Auto Packet Detection Enabled property is set to False. Otherwise, the value will be discarded.

The default value is 0x71764129.

Note  This property is valid for all LE packets.
